Output 057dc29bb17c3f4f1c08eb95182959b61f1b3830f2d6ea1a20744fc61e940ecf:0

value
1443454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 699bf92a54f054e189ce1f0e821a28bc5ff3c47b OP_EQUAL
address
3BKRiuD8E2zNAe9LrJ5PwuL23R15EusLUq
transaction
057dc29bb17c3f4f1c08eb95182959b61f1b3830f2d6ea1a20744fc61e940ecf
spent
true